ENS 532432 March 2018 18:00:00Agreement StateAgreement State Report - Source Retraction FailureThe following information was obtained from the State of Texas via email: On March 3, 2018, the Agency (Texas Department of State and Health Services) received notice that a source retraction failure had occurred on March 2, 2018 around 1200 CST. The camera was a QSA Global 880D with a 61 Curie Iridium-192 source. During source retrieval the crank cables snapped and the source was just outside the camera. The Radiation Safety Officer (RSO) reported to the scene and covered up the source with shielding. The RSO made multiple trips to cover the source with lead and after he completed the operation he noticed his 0-200 mrem pocket dosimeter was off scale. The RSO will send off his film badge for an emergency reading on March 5, 2018. No other personnel received any excessive dose from the event. Additional information will be supplied as it is received in accordance with SA-300. Texas Incident #: I-9550
